Speech Therapy
Speech Therapy Research-Based at Bright Centre offers evidence-based speech and language intervention using the Analysis of Verbal Behaviour method. The centre specialises in treating specific components of the language system through scientifically proven techniques.
The centre employs comprehensive speech therapy techniques including modelling, recasting, phonetic and phonemic awareness, and metalinguistic strategies. Treatment interventions include listening processing input therapy, speech perception therapy, oral motor therapy, and literacy acquisition support.
BICC incorporates experience-based learning through natural language paradigm, incidental teaching strategy, interrupted behaviour chains, and pivotal response teaching. These approaches are implemented in natural learning situations to develop language processing skills and support appropriate behaviours.
The centre applies established Applied Behaviour Analysis principles including reinforcement contingencies, prompting, fading, chaining, and floor-time techniques to support communication development and behavioural goals.
